summaryrefslogtreecommitdiffstats
path: root/third_party/rust/wgpu-core/src/instance.rs
diff options
context:
space:
mode:
authorDaniel Baumann <daniel.baumann@progress-linux.org>2024-04-19 01:13:27 +0000
committerDaniel Baumann <daniel.baumann@progress-linux.org>2024-04-19 01:13:27 +0000
commit40a355a42d4a9444dc753c04c6608dade2f06a23 (patch)
tree871fc667d2de662f171103ce5ec067014ef85e61 /third_party/rust/wgpu-core/src/instance.rs
parentAdding upstream version 124.0.1. (diff)
downloadfirefox-adbda400be353e676059e335c3c0aaf99e719475.tar.xz
firefox-adbda400be353e676059e335c3c0aaf99e719475.zip
Adding upstream version 125.0.1.upstream/125.0.1
Signed-off-by: Daniel Baumann <daniel.baumann@progress-linux.org>
Diffstat (limited to 'third_party/rust/wgpu-core/src/instance.rs')
-rw-r--r--third_party/rust/wgpu-core/src/instance.rs22
1 files changed, 11 insertions, 11 deletions
diff --git a/third_party/rust/wgpu-core/src/instance.rs b/third_party/rust/wgpu-core/src/instance.rs
index 582571c2b8..b909245fac 100644
--- a/third_party/rust/wgpu-core/src/instance.rs
+++ b/third_party/rust/wgpu-core/src/instance.rs
@@ -198,7 +198,7 @@ impl<A: HalApi> Adapter<A> {
Self {
raw,
- info: ResourceInfo::new("<Adapter>"),
+ info: ResourceInfo::new("<Adapter>", None),
}
}
@@ -303,7 +303,7 @@ impl<A: HalApi> Adapter<A> {
let queue = Queue {
device: None,
raw: Some(hal_device.queue),
- info: ResourceInfo::new("<Queue>"),
+ info: ResourceInfo::new("<Queue>", None),
};
return Ok((device, queue));
}
@@ -521,7 +521,7 @@ impl Global {
let surface = Surface {
presentation: Mutex::new(None),
- info: ResourceInfo::new("<Surface>"),
+ info: ResourceInfo::new("<Surface>", None),
raw: hal_surface,
};
@@ -542,7 +542,7 @@ impl Global {
let surface = Surface {
presentation: Mutex::new(None),
- info: ResourceInfo::new("<Surface>"),
+ info: ResourceInfo::new("<Surface>", None),
raw: {
let hal_surface = self
.instance
@@ -575,7 +575,7 @@ impl Global {
let surface = Surface {
presentation: Mutex::new(None),
- info: ResourceInfo::new("<Surface>"),
+ info: ResourceInfo::new("<Surface>", None),
raw: {
let hal_surface = self
.instance
@@ -604,7 +604,7 @@ impl Global {
let surface = Surface {
presentation: Mutex::new(None),
- info: ResourceInfo::new("<Surface>"),
+ info: ResourceInfo::new("<Surface>", None),
raw: {
let hal_surface = self
.instance
@@ -633,7 +633,7 @@ impl Global {
let surface = Surface {
presentation: Mutex::new(None),
- info: ResourceInfo::new("<Surface>"),
+ info: ResourceInfo::new("<Surface>", None),
raw: {
let hal_surface = self
.instance
@@ -1072,10 +1072,10 @@ impl Global {
let device = hub.devices.get(device_id).unwrap();
queue.device = Some(device.clone());
- let (queue_id, _) = queue_fid.assign(queue);
+ let (queue_id, queue) = queue_fid.assign(queue);
resource_log!("Created Queue {:?}", queue_id);
- device.queue_id.write().replace(queue_id);
+ device.set_queue(queue);
return (device_id, queue_id, None);
};
@@ -1124,10 +1124,10 @@ impl Global {
let device = hub.devices.get(device_id).unwrap();
queue.device = Some(device.clone());
- let (queue_id, _) = queues_fid.assign(queue);
+ let (queue_id, queue) = queues_fid.assign(queue);
resource_log!("Created Queue {:?}", queue_id);
- device.queue_id.write().replace(queue_id);
+ device.set_queue(queue);
return (device_id, queue_id, None);
};